1964 Ford Zodiac vs. 1995 Peugeot 406

To start off, 1995 Peugeot 406 is newer by 31 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1964 Ford Zodiac.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1964 Ford Zodiac would be higher. At 2,553 cc (6 cylinders), 1964 Ford Zodiac is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1964 Ford Zodiac (108 HP @ 4750 RPM) has 19 more horse power than 1995 Peugeot 406. (89 HP @ 5000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1964 Ford Zodiac should accelerate faster than 1995 Peugeot 406.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1964 Ford Zodiac weights approximately 25 kg more than 1995 Peugeot 406.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Because 1964 Ford Zodiac is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 1964 Ford Zodiac.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1995 Peugeot 406,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1964 Ford Zodiac (191 Nm @ 2900 RPM) has 44 more torque (in Nm) than 1995 Peugeot 406. (147 Nm @ 2600 RPM). This means 1964 Ford Zodiac will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1995 Peugeot 406.
